The Role of Third Party Inspection Companies in UAE


Independent evaluations have become a cornerstone of industrial reliability. UAE third party inspection companies offer impartial assessments to verify compliance with laws and technical requirements. Equipment like cranes, forklifts, pressure vessels, and lifting tools must undergo inspection before being cleared for use.

A certified inspection service in UAE minimises equipment breakdowns, lowers insurance costs, and supports uninterrupted productivity. Detailed reports provided by inspectors ensure full transparency and reliability in documentation.

The Value of ADNOC Approved Third Party Inspection Companies


In the oil and gas industry, partnering with ADNOC-certified inspection companies is a mandatory requirement. The company maintains exceptionally high HSE standards across its operations. Such firms carry out detailed assessments on tools, machinery, and systems to ensure conformity with ADNOC safety policies.

Contractors depend on these checks to meet ADNOC project standards promptly. They also help maintain the reputation of companies involved in high-risk operations across offshore and onshore facilities.

Why Safety Training Courses in UAE Are Vital


A robust safety culture starts with proper training. Inspection and safety training courses in UAE equip staff with critical safety knowledge for challenging industrial settings. Courses typically cover crane operations, forklift handling, rigging and slinging, scaffolding, and first aid.

Enrolling in a Safety Training Course in UAE ensures that workers understand operational hazards, know how to use protective gear, and follow correct procedures. Such training reduces accidents and promotes a strong culture of safety.

Tips for Selecting a Reliable Third Party Inspection Company in the UAE


Choosing the correct inspection company demands due diligence. Key factors to consider include:
• Proper UAE-recognised certifications and accreditations.
• Inspectors with hands-on industry experience.
• Experience working across major sectors like oil, gas, and construction.
• Transparent reporting systems and quick inspection turnaround times.
